About The Position

The US Wealth Operations Specialist I is an introductory role to Wealth that performs specialized operational tasks in support of one or more US Wealth Management lines of business. Depth & Scope: Performs basic administrative support tasks while maintaining excellent quality in reporting and responding to clients both internal and external Is competent in at lease one core Wealth Systems (Tracker, Netx360, FIS Trust Desk) as well as other role specific systems (Fidelity, Lotus Notes, Transtar among others) as needed Perform basic processing Ensures transactions are confirmed and entered in system, according to established policies and procedures for each type of transaction Resolves problems with transactions by communicating directly with client facing advisors, clients and 3rd parties advisors With oversight Prepares detailed information and reports on transactions and accounts as needed Provides direction and answers to basic questions as needed Adheres to established quality standards for all work performed Supports Trackers / Phones/ email to advise and assist client facing CSA's Accountabilities are of moderate complexity and scope and performed under general management supervision. Review basic reconciliation breaks

Requirements

  • Undergraduate Degree or High School Diploma with 3+ years related experience required
  • A minimum of SIE & Series 99 registration is required; If hired without licenses, candidate will need to acquire within a defined period outlined at time of hire
  • Knowledge of accounting entries and procedures
  • Knowledge of trust operations processes
  • Strong arithmetic skills
  • Strong organizational skills
  • Time management skills
  • Attention to detail
  • Interpersonal skills
  • Communication skills, both verbal and written
  • PC skills
  • Must be eligible for employment under standards established by FINRA.
  • Subject to the investigation and verification requirements of FINRA Rule 3110(e)
  • Satisfactory results on a criminal background check, credit report check, civil litigation search, and regulatory agency or self-regulatory organization enforcement action search, and statements/certification from job applicant regarding administrative, civil, and/or criminal findings by any government agency/authority or self-regulatory organization, are required by federal law for this position
